Lapis lazuli is a beautiful opaque stone ranging in color from a deep blue to denim. Lapis lazuli can be made of several minerals besides lazurite, namely sodalite, hauyne, calcite (white streaks), and pyrite (metallic streaks or flecks). Stones that are deep blue with small patches of pyrite and calcite are considered the most valuable. The ancients believed that divine favor and success came to those wearing lapis. It was largely reserved for royalty. Claims to origins of lapis lazuli range from Afghanistan and ancient Babylon to Peru and the Inca civilization. Regardless, those who wore lapis claimed that "power amulets" were formed when this beautiful stone was shaped into the form of an eye and ornamented with gold.
